What are the responsibilities and job description for the Early Childhood Teacher (Self Contained) position at Woodridge School District 68?
- Demonstrates knowledge and understanding of subject matter content.
- Identifies, selects and modifies instructional materials to meet the needs of students with varying backgrounds, learning styles and special needs.
- Creates a classroom environment that is conducive to learning and ensures the emotional and educational development of students.
- Uses Board adopted materials, district curriculum guides and supplementary instruction materials that are most appropriate for meeting State and District standards.
- Provides quality work for students that is challenging and relevant to the goals and objectives of the class that enhances critical thinking skills.
- Monitors and analyzes student learning and behavior on a regular basis, seeking the assistance of district specialists as required.
- Provides a pleasant and stimulating classroom environment, which might include: displaying samples of student work and arranging attractive bulletin boards.
- Plans and prepares lessons and strategies, which are meaningful and engaging and supports the School Improvement Plans and District Strategic Goals.
- Establishes an environment in which students are encouraged to be actively engaged in the learning process.
- Utilizes effective assessment strategies to assist in the continuous development of students.
- Administers district assessments and provides progress reports as required.
- Demonstrates skill in use of positive reinforcement techniques related to student achievement and behavior to create a safe learning environment.
- Engages in ongoing quest for reflection and personal growth through inservice, classes and study.
- Assists in assessing changing curricular needs and plans for improvement.
- Assists in enforcement of school rules, administrative regulations and School Board Policies.
- Communicates effectively, both orally and in writing, with other professionals, students, parents and the community to enhance the instructional environment.
- Actively participates in school activities, services and programs during and outside the instructional day when required or requested to do so under reasonable terms.
- Makes provisions for being available to students and parents for education-related purposes outside the instructional day when required or requested to do so under reasonable terms.
- Responds to communications within the school district, (e-mail, voice mail, interoffice memos, postal mail) in a timely manner.
- Presents a positive school image and realizes the importance of establishing good school-community relations.
- Models professional and ethical conduct when dealing with students, peers, parents and the community.
- Instructs and supervises the work of volunteers and aides when assigned.
- Manages time, materials and equipment effectively.
- Establishes and maintains effective and efficient record keeping procedures.
- Performs other tasks consistent with the goals and objectives of this position.
